Bigger Than Idol, Oscars, Olympics

Huge numbers for Obama’s speech last night. Barack Obama’s acceptance speech at the Democratic National Convention was seen by more than 38 million people. Nielsen Media Research said more people watched Obama speak than watched the Olympics opening ceremony in Beijing, the final “American Idol” or the Academy Awards this year. Obama talked before a live audience of 80,000 people …

No Biden Bounce: Hillerites Abandon Obama Over VP Pick

According to a CNN poll taken this weekend, Barack Obama’s pick of Joe Biden as running mate has cost him among die-hard Hillary supporters and provided no “bounce” in his popularity. Sixty-six percent of Clinton supporters, registered Democrats who want Clinton as the nominee, are now backing Obama. That’s down from 75 percent in the end of June. Twenty-seven percent …
